  • Warner Promises To Share Equity From Proceeds Of Streaming Service Sales

    While much of the blame for low payouts to artists from streaming has been laid at the feet of the services themselves, the opaque nature of how things are handles by major labels deserves a lot of the blame as well. Warner Music Group is looking to gain a little good will from their artists in a new announcement today, saying that the label would share some of the equity from a potential sale of a streaming service that it is invested in, like Spotify.
  • DJ Big Kap Dead: Cause Of Death Revealed By Road Manager

    Yesterday, Feb. 3 New York City lost one beloved veteran in the hip-hop scene, DJ Big Kap. The longtime DJ and collaborator with the likes of Notorious B.I.G., Funkmaster Flex and Nas was found dead in the morning. Now the cause of death has been revealed to be a heart attack by his road manager Ab Traxx.

  • Tom DeLonge Announces New Angels & Airwaves Music, Extraterrestrial Series 'Sekret Machines'

    When Tom DeLonge and Blink-182 parted ways last year, the pop-punk musician teased that he was going to enter the world of science fiction, and now he has delivered. On Thursday (Feb. 4), DeLonge announced the release of Sekret Machines, a "a transmedia series that will include new music from Angels & Airwaves, fiction and non-fiction books, and an eye-opening documentary" which is due for release this spring.
